Composition and Care
Premium materials and clear care guidelines to ensure instrument longevity and performance.Our instruments are crafted from surgical-grade stainless steel (316L), MRI-safe titanium, or medical polymers for single-use applications. For reusable tools:
- Sterilize via autoclave (135°C/275°F for 15–20 minutes) or plasma/EtO methods.
-
Store in dry, non-humid environments using silicone-coated trays.
-
Maintain with monthly hinge lubrication using instrument-grade oil.
Description
Corneal forceps are delicate surgical instruments used in ophthalmology for grasping and manipulating corneal tissue during procedures such as corneal transplantation, cataract surgery, and refractive surgery. These ophthalmology corneal forceps are designed with fine tips to minimize trauma to the delicate corneal layers. We offer Corneal Forceps in different types including Corneal Suturing Forceps (Straight) and Corneal Suturing Forceps (Curved), designed for holding and passing sutures through the cornea with different jaw configurations for surgical preference; and Corneal Tissue Forceps (Toothed) and Corneal Tissue Forceps (Smooth), for grasping corneal tissue with varying levels of grip depending on the surgical need.
